Regarding power: The peak power of this product is 30W (test when the battery is full, only 3-5 seconds are allowed), and the rated power is 24W (when the battery power is greater than 50%, it can be tested.The value of the valley value is 18W (the battery is tested when the battery is about to be exhausted, and this power is allowed for a long time). Since the battery cannot be fully used in the use of the battery, the user can only useWhat is the label on the device, but the actual power cannot exceed 18W, otherwise there is a risk of overheating and restarting. As for the 24W power, it can only be used for a few minutes or tens of minutes when the battery is full, but this power cannot be used for a long time!Unless you hang an additional temperature control fan to cool the motherboard, if you heat dissipate well, you can continue to load 24W power for a long time!
Regarding the fever: When the battery is fully charged at 18W, the heat is 60-70 degrees, the heat is 70-80 degrees when the battery remains half, and the heat is 80-90 degrees when the battery is exhausted.-80 degrees, when the battery power is less than 50%, the load 24W will cause the chip to exceed 90 degrees, and then trigger overheating protection. The chip is restarted repeatedly. As a result, it is easy to damage. Do not use it overload!
Method about determining whether it is overloaded: After connecting the load after power -on, the high -temperature area of the back of the motherboard is touched by your finger. If you can withstand more than half a minute, it means that it is not overload!
Regarding the input current: For non-professional users, the input current must be greater than 12V3A. The 4-5A current is better. When leaving more margins, it can reduce the temperature of the external power supply. For professional-level users, there is no need to pay attention to this parameter.Ensure that external power supply power is greater than charging+loads. For example, the load is 0.5A, the charging is 0.5A, and the external power supply is enough to connect 12V 1.5A! Novice does not understand this, so you must refer to the provisions of the use of the use, otherwise you will encounter various each.An annoying question!

Basic parameter table
Product name: 24W switching DC UPS module v4.0
Product power: instant 30W/rated 24W/available 18W
Battery type: 7.4-8.4V lithium battery/support 18650
Charging method: trickle/constant current/constant voltage three -stage charging
Charging current: Fast charging mode about 0.9A-1A charging current
Switching threshold: When the voltage falls 0.8V, the battery is powered on the battery
Product function: charging+battery voltage+switching+overlap protection
工作电压:默认12V模式/输入电流应>3A
Battery capacity: slow charging to 4-6AH, fast charge 4-12AH
Charging voltage: voltage range 8.2-8.4V average 8.3V
Dowlving voltage: The battery is lower than 6.0V-6.4V automatically disconnect
Path loss:: FUSE and SS54 loss is about 0.4V-0.6V
Protection function and precautions
Input protection: IN input interface has anti -connection protection functions
Battery protection: Battery interface Passing protection+short -circuit protection
Charging protection: Enable a trickle charging mode when the battery is under voltage
Disable power supply: prohibit interference or unstable power supply
Output protection: The output interface has a short -circuit protection function
LED protection: external LED, the lead must not touch the power supply
Chip protection: Close or restart when the chip exceeds 120 degrees
Disable load: prohibit connection motor or electromagnetic load
The battery type battery line must be thick, otherwise it will produce interference or insufficient output power
